FILMOGRAPHY DIGNA SINKE

 

2010 WISTFUL WILDERNESS (WEEMOED & WILDERNIS), final documentary about the island of Tiengemeten 1996-2009 and temporality (88 min, script & direction)

2010 NEW TIENGEMETEN, documentary (53 min for NPS television, script & direction), part 3 of a series  about  the island of Tiengemeten

2009 DREAMLAND, ARCHIVALIA nr 09-001, short film (5 min)  for art project Neighbours in Delden (direction, camera, editing)

2008 ATLANTIS, fiction feature film about a 13 year-old girl trying to find her way in nearby future (85 min, script & direction) with Pitou Nicolaes, Yorrin Kootstra, Annemarie Prins and Bert Luppes

2006 TIENGEMETEN 2001 - 2006 (80 min and 54 min for NPS television, script & direction), part 2 of a series about the island of Tiengemeten
Competitie Nederlands Film Festival 2006

2005 BROSSA, documentary on the Catalan poet and visual artist Joan Brossa and his fascination for film (in the framework of Le Cinéma Invisible, 70 min en 55 min voor VPRO, script & direction)

2001 TIENGEMETEN, documentary (77 min, script & direction), part 1 of a long term project on nature, landscape and changes on the island of Tiengemeten

1999 SPACE TO THINK (LUCHT OM NA TE DENKEN), video film (37 min) commissioned by the Foundation for Fine Arts, Design and Architecture BKVB (script, direction, editing)

1998 DE FAMILIE BOM, home movie about the genealogy of the Zeeland family Bom (script, direction, editing)

1993 BELLE VAN ZUYLEN / MADAME DE CHARRIERE, fiction feature film and 3 part series for NPS television on the friendship between the Dutch novelist Belle van Zuylen and Benjamin Constant (105 min, script & direction), with Will van Kralingen, Laus Steenbeeke

1992 ABOVE THE MOUNTAINS (BOVEN DE BERGEN), fiction feature film about a group of people on a long distance walk from north to south in the Netherlands, looking for "the mountains" (107 min, script & direction), met Catherine ten Bruggencate, Johan Leysen, Eric Corton, Esgo Heil, Roos Blaauboer en Renée Fokker

1990 FAREWELL (AFSCHEID), short experimental film about industrial objects (regie en montage)

1990 NOTHING LASTS FOREVER (NIETS VOOOR DE EEUWIGHEID), feature documentary on industrial archaeology in the Nederlands (74 min, script & direction)

1989 DE BRIEF (The Letter), video project with students of the School for Performing Arts Amsterdam (Toneelschool) (script, direction, editing

1985 NEW WAVE (DE NIEUWE GOLF), feature documentary on avant-garde music in the Netherlands (87 min, script & direction)

1984 THE SILENT PACIFIC (DE STILLE OCEAAN),  fiction feature (105 min, direction), with Josée Ruiter, Josse de Pauw, Andrea Domburg; 
Competition Berlinale 1984
Valladolid 1984
Athens 1985

1982 DE HOOP VAN HET VADERLAND (The Hope of the Fatherland), feature documentary on the history of a school paper and why most people did not become poets (90 min, script, direction, editing)

1979 CARRY VAN BRUGGEN, documentary about the Dutch novelist Carry van Bruggen for NOS television (50 min, script & direction)

1978 BALLET, WHAT'S THAT FOR? (BALLET WAARVOOR DIENT DAT?), commissioned film on educational activities of the Scapino ballet (38 min, script & direction)
Prix de Qualité 1978

1978 A VAN GOGH ON THE WALL (EEN VAN GOGH AAN DE MUUR), documentary about the reproduction of the painting Terrace by Night by Van Gogh, for NOS television (50 min, script & direction),
Candidate Prix Italia 1978

1975 THE HELLE BROTHERS (DE GEBROEDERS HELLE), short fiction film about a mother and two sons in a small village (28 min, script & direction), with Cor van Rijn, Hidde Maas, Jeanne Verstraete and Loes Vos

1973 STADRAND (City Border), two documentaries on the city border of Amsterdam (direction, co-direction and editing)

1972 GROETEN UIT ZONNEMAIRE (Greetings from Zonnemaire), short fiction film (24 min, script & direction), final exam film for the Nederlandse Film & Televisie Academie
